Weakened pipeline joints


Pipeline joints are the parts of our plumbing system where the pipelines connect. They are the weakest factor of our plumbing system. Because of this, they are much more at risk to damage. It is vital to keep in mind that despite the fact that pipes are made to hold up against pressure and also last for some time, they weren't created to last for life; for that reason, they would wear away with time. This wear and tear might result in fractures in plumbing systems. An usual indicator of damaged pipeline joints is too much noise from faucets.

High water pressure


You noticed your residence water pressure is greater than usual however after that, why should you care? It runs out your control.
It would certainly be best if you cared because your average water pressure need to be 60 Psi (per square inch) as well as although your house's plumbing system is created to endure 80 Psi. A rise in water pressure can place a stress on your house pipes as well as result in splits, or even worse, ruptured pipelines. If you ever before discover that your house water stress is higher than typical, connect with a professional about managing it.

Corrosion


As your pipework grows older, it obtains weak as well as extra prone to rust after the regular passage of water through them, which can eat away at pipelines and also trigger fractures. A visible indicator of deterioration in your house plumbing system is staining and also although this might be tough to spot because of a lot of pipelines hidden away. We encourage doing a regular check-up every couple of years and also alter pipelines once they are old to guarantee a sound plumbing system

Obstructed drains


Food bits, dust, and also oil can create blocked drains and obstruct the flow of water in and out of your sink. Increased stress within the seamless gutters can finish and also cause an overflow up cracking or breaking pipes if undealt with. To avoid blocked drains in your home, we advise you to avoid pouring particles down the drain and also routine cleaning of sinks.

Busted seals


An additional source of water leakages in houses is broken seals of home devices that use water, e.g., a dishwasher. When such home appliances are set up, seals are mounted around water ports for very easy passage of water via the equipment. Thus, a damaged seal can trigger leakage of water when in operation.

A Water Leak is More Than Just a Nuisance


Most water leaks fall into four main categories: roof leaks, burst pipes, leaking fixtures, and leaking underground drains. If you suspect a leak, you should act quickly and try to locate the source of the leak as soon as possible. An experienced plumber can repair it before it progresses and causes greater or even irreparable damage.


What to do if you suspect a water leak?


  • Turn off the water at the meter - Locate your water meter (read our handy guide here) and turn it off.


  • Turn on your garden tap – this will allow the water still in the system to run out there, rather than putting more pressure on the burst or leaking pipe
